Yeah, android partially supports G.711, and Sipdroid uses G.711alaw
internally.
The problem is that G.711 isn't an ideal codec for using over 3G. G.
729, AMR, Speex, GSM, or iLBC would all be better :)
And Android has some native support for AMR as well.